2. The Gnome terminal won't start (the Shell Console terminal works):
# /usr/bin/gnome-terminal
(gnome-terminal:25432): Gtk-WARNING **: GModule (/usr/lib64/gtk-2.0/2.10.0/engines/libclearlooks.so) initialization check failed: Gtk+ version too old (micro mismatch)
rpm -q gtk2-engines gtk2 ? It probably means you don't have gtk2 2.16 installed. Magnus' explanation for this makes sense.
